To knit the most basic ribbed stitch for hat brims, K1, P1 is very popular. It is stretchy and is referred to as the Standard 1×1 Rib. Many hats use this ribbing for their brim, especially baby hats. WebApr 1, 2024 · Insert the left needle through the front of the stitch below the stitch on the needle, then allow the stitch on the right needle to slide off. Tug the working yarn to release it. For a knit stitch, enter through the center of the V formed by the stitch. For a purl stitch, insert the needle just under the purl bump.

WebIt is often necessary to slip (sl) a stitch from one needle to the other without actually knitting or purling it. This method is often used in shaping or within a stitch pattern. The pattern will usually specify whether to slip the stitch knitwise (as if to knit) or purlwise (as if to purl). If it does not say, slip the stitch purlwise.
